Northern Coalfields Limited (NCL), a subsidiary of Coal India Limited, has achieved its coal production target of 140 million tonnes (MT) ahead of the scheduled timeline, marking a significant milestone in the country’s energy sector.
The achievement reflects NCL’s operational efficiency and its sustained efforts to enhance coal output to meet the growing energy demands of the nation. The company has consistently adopted advanced mining technologies, improved logistics, and optimized resource utilization to boost productivity.
NCL plays a crucial role in ensuring fuel supply to thermal power plants across the country, thereby contributing significantly to India’s power generation capacity. Early achievement of the production target is expected to strengthen coal availability and support uninterrupted electricity generation.
The milestone aligns with the Government of India’s focus on ensuring energy security and improving the performance of public sector enterprises. It also underscores the commitment of Coal India Limited towards achieving higher production targets and enhancing efficiency across its subsidiaries.
